Definitions:

Transitions

Changes in state or conditions within a system's process that trigger specific actions or sequences in control programming.

Counter Rung

A ladder logic diagram element that tracks and controls occurrences of an event within a PLC program.

Parameter

A variable or factor that can be set or adjusted in order to influence or determine a process or system's behavior.

External Trigger

A signal or event from outside a system that initiates a process or action within the system.
